There are now bills in both the house and senate clarifying that the use of a pesticide consistent with its registration under the Federal Insecticide, Fungicide and Rodenticide Act (FIFRA) should not be subject to a costly, redundant and unnecessary permit process under the Clean Water Act. And Keith Menchey, manager of science and environmental issues for the National Cotton Council, says even if the bills do not pass this year, it puts a place holder in for next congress as well as sends a strong message to the EPA.
